Given equilateral triangle OAB.

OA = OB = AB = 8 units.

Draw BD ⊥ OA.

In an equilateral triangle, a perpendicular drawn from one of the vertices to the opposite side bisects the side.

∴ OD = 12\dfrac{1}{2} x OA = ​12\dfrac{1}{2} x 8 = 4.

In right angle triangle OBD,

By pythagoras theorem,

⇒ OB2 = OD2 + BD2

⇒ 82 = 42 + BD2

⇒ 64 = 16 + BD2

⇒ BD2 = 64 - 16

⇒ BD2 = 48

⇒ BD = 48\sqrt{48}

⇒ BD = 434\sqrt{3}

From graph,

Co-ordinates of O = (0, 0)

Co-ordinates of A = (8, 0)

As, OD = 4 units and BD = 434\sqrt{3} units.

Co-ordinates of B = (4, 434\sqrt{3}).

∴ Statement 1 is false, and statement 2 is true.

Hence, option 4 is the correct option.
